Type: Recon chopper
Armament: x2 Helldart pods, Sidewinders
Armour Class: Light
Speed: Fast
Cost: $1250
Purpose: Close air support, Anti-air
Requires: Armour Facility, Airforce Command HQ
Strong against: Massed units, Aircrafts
Weak against: Anti-Air

---

Additional Info
- gains Armour bonus on veteran
- gains Speed bonus on veteran
- gains Firepower bonus on elite
- gains ROF bonus on elite
- gains Self-repair on elite
- gains HEAT warheads on elite, increasing efficiency against vehicles (primary weapon)
- gains laser-guidance systems on elite, increasing range and firepower (secondary weapon)
- invisible to radar

---

The Eurocopter Sparrowhawk is a new recon chopper recently deployed to aid Comanches, which were themselves originally meant to be recon choppers before development shifted them to being made as full-blown helicopter gunships. Being lighter, Sparrowhawks are faster and cheaper to produce, allowing them to quickly scout out the map ahead of it's big brother. They are armed with a pair of rocket pods which can each unleash a storm of Helldart rockets, softening up groups of ground forces and making them easy pickings for Comanches or any other friendly ground units. Sparrowhawks also make up for the Comanches' shortcoming of lacking any anti-air capability by being armed with Sidewinder missiles, effective at bringing down most kinds of aircrafts. A combined force of Comanches and Sparrowhawks is usually an effective tactic, with both choppers being able to eliminate ground forces quickly and protect each other from their respective weaknesses, save for heavy anti-air.
